3 min readPuneJul 25, 2026 10:06 AM IST Born with a congenital deformity that left her without a right knee joint, with two fingers on her right hand and four on her left, 18-year-old Kavita Arora from Jammu has undergone years of medical treatment. She underwent an above-the-knee amputation at the age of five and was fitted with a prosthetic leg at Pune’s Artificial Limb Centre (ALC) when she was six. Now in Pune for a routine medical review and prosthetic maintenance, Kavita is preparing for the next step in her journey — securing admission to a medical college. “I was not able to attend coaching classes regularly because I sometimes found it difficult to walk, but I studied well and was expecting to score over 300 marks after appearing for NEET in May,” she told The Indian Express. “Then the paper leak led to a re-examination. Prime Minister Narendra Modi arrived in New Zealand on Friday on the final leg of a three-nation tour that has focused on shoring up economic and security cooperation with key countries in the Indo-Pacific region amid geopolitical churn on the international stage exacerbated by conflicts. Prime Minister Narendra Modi reached New Zealand after visits to Indonesia and Australia for talks on trade, security and regional cooperation. (DPR PMO) Modi flew into Auckland, where he was received at the airport by New Zealand Prime Minister Christopher Luxon, after visits to Indonesia and Australia that witnessed the unveiling of a range of measures to deepen cooperation in defence and key sectors such as critical minerals and emerging technologies. India finalised deals to supply the BrahMos cruise missile and Astra air-to-air missile to Indonesia, and concluded a landmark agreement with Australia for long-term uranium supplies. Modi and Luxon are set to hold talks to review bilateral relations and the regional situation at Government House in Auckland on Saturday. A repeat offender wanted in multiple theft cases was shot in the leg by police after he attacked a constable with a knife and an iron rod while attempting to evade arrest near Bongulur Gate on the Outer Ring Road on Tuesday night. According to the police, a team from Nalgonda district acted on a tip-off that the accused, identified as Bhushmi Srikanth, was travelling in a goods carrier vehicle. The team tried to arrest him near Adibatla. Police said Srikanth attacked a Nalgonda police constable with a knife and an iron rod before trying to flee. In response, the police opened fire, injuring him in the leg and bringing the chase to an end. Srikanth, a native of Andhra Pradesh, was shifted to a hospital in Vanasthalipuram for treatment before being taken to Nalgonda for further investigation. Prime Minister Narendra Modi waves as he departs from Nice for an official visit to Slovakia. | Photo Credit: ANI Prime Minister Narendra Modi arrived in Slovakia for the second leg of his two-nation visit, where he will hold talks with President Peter Pellegrini and Prime Minister Robert Fico and interact with business leaders. Mr. Modi is the first Indian Prime Minister to visit Slovakia since its independence in 1993. In a post on X after reaching the Slovakian capital, Mr. Modi said, “This visit provides an opportunity to deepen India-Slovakia relations and explore new avenues of cooperation. Looking forward to productive meetings with President Pellegrini and Prime Minister Fico.” The Prime Minister arrived in Bratislava on a two-day visit from France where he held bilateral talks with French President Emmanuel Macron in Nice. Harmanpreet Singh has returned to captain the Indian men’s hockey team as Hockey India announced a 24-member squad for the European leg of the FIH Pro League 2025-26. Harmanpreet had missed the Hobart leg of the tournament earlier this year due to personal reasons and now returns to lead the side for crucial matches against the Netherlands, Germany, England and Pakistan. The Indian team will first travel to Brussels, Belgium, for a preparatory training camp and a friendly match from June 7 to 9 before beginning the Pro League fixtures in Rotterdam. India will face the Netherlands and Germany between June 14 and 21 in the Netherlands before travelling to London for matches against Pakistan and England from June 23 to 28.
